调试Python代码:常见问题及解决方案
在调试Python代码时,可能会遇到以下几种常见的问题以及解决方案:
语法错误:
- 现象:编译器报错。
- 解决方案:检查每个语句的缩进和括号是否正确。
类型错误:
- 现象:运行时提示数据类型不匹配。
- 解决方案:检查变量在使用前的类型声明,或者将可能混用的数据转换为同一类型。
逻辑错误:
- 现象:代码能执行但结果不符合预期。
- 解决方案:仔细阅读代码并理解其功能,通过添加打印语句或调试器来逐步检查逻辑流程。
资源不足(如内存、文件等):
- 现象:程序运行时出现 Out of Memory 或相关错误。
- 解决方案:优化代码以减少内存使用;如果需要处理大量数据,考虑使用更高效的存储方式或算法。
以上就是调试Python代码时可能会遇到的常见问题以及解决方案。希望对你有所帮助!
还没有评论,来说两句吧...